Lucy Danforth

Birth23 Feb 1759 - Reading, Middlesex County, Province of Massachusetts Bay
Death15 JUN 1853 - Saugus, Essex, MA, USA
MotherKeziah Reed Danforth
FatherJOSHUA DANFORTH

Born in Reading, Middlesex County, Province of Massachusetts Bay on 23 Feb 1759 to JOSHUA DANFORTH and Keziah Reed Danforth. Lucy Danforth married William Sweetser and had 10 children. She passed away on 15 JUN 1853 in Saugus, Essex, MA, USA.
